Description
A flavorful and spicy dish featuring chicken marinated in gochujang, a Korean chili paste, perfect for those who love a kick in their meals.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 lb chicken thighs, boneless and skinless
- 2 tablespoons gochujang
- 1 tablespoon soy sauce
- 1 tablespoon honey
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on ginger, grated
- 1 tablespoon sesame oil
- 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
- 2 green onions, chopped
- Sesame seeds for garnish
Instructions
- In a bowl, mix gochujang, soy sauce, honey, garlic, ginger, and sesame oil to create the marinade.
- Add the chicken thighs to the marinade, ensuring they are well coated. Let it marinate for at least 30 minutes.
- Heat vegetable oil in a skillet over medium-high heat.
- Add the marinated chicken to the skillet and cook for about 6-7 minutes on each side, or until fully cooked.
- Remove from heat and let it rest for a few minutes before slicing.
- Garnish with chopped green onions and sesame seeds before serving.
Notes
- For extra heat, add more gochujang to the marinade.
- This dish pairs well with steamed rice or vegetables.
-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
